Barnes & Noble Acquired by Elliott Management for $683M
June 7, 2019 at 2:23 pm

Hedge fund Elliott Management announced Friday that the firm will acquire bookseller Barnes & Noble for $683 million, reports CNBC. The acquisition is set to close in the third quarter of 2019, and will be structured as a merger. FTD Files for Chapter 11 Bankruptcy Protection
June 3, 2019 at 2:30 pm

Flower-delivery provider FTD Cos. filed for chapter 11 bankruptcy protection Monday in the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the District of Delaware, with plans to auction off its businesses while paying down debt. Natura to Buy Avon Products for About $2B in Stock
May 24, 2019 at 9:10 am

Brazilโ€™s Natura Cosmeticos SA agreed to buy rival Avon Products Inc. in an all-stock deal valued at about $2 billion, positioning it as a growing force in the booming global cosmetics and skincare industry. Shaving Startup Harryโ€™s Sold to Owner of Schick for $1.37B
May 9, 2019 at 12:50 pm

Edgewell Personal Care, the company that owns the Schick and Wilkinson razor brands as well as Hawaiian Tropic, plans to announce on Thursday that it will buy Harryโ€™s for about $1.37 billion in stock and cash.
